It does not matter what motor you buy. What you need to match up is the sensors and harness to the ECU. So in your case make sure you get the USDM SR20DE sensors to put in what ever motor you get. Not sure if the RR motors are tuned differently than the others but i am guessing you should be fine.

just like everyone already said.. You need to make sure you use usdm sensors that are all 96 or newer. The red top engine looks like a euro sr20de which is a 10:1 compression and the other one is a roller rocker which will be 9.5:1 compression. So if you ever decide to go turbo this is something you might want to consider. At the end of the day you can get both of them to work

Make sure your dizzy has two plugs for your 96 harness.need usdm intake manifold 95-99 to retain egr. If you get this used complete soak the egr in brake cleaner or throttle body cleaner for a while and clean with pipeople brush and shots of air.replace all vacuum lines buy an ebay header with egr port.roller rocker from what I heard is a good replacement.especially with b14 manifold.make sure to use a 95-97 ecu b14 or g20.Whatever year ecu same yea coolant temp sensor.new knock sensor same year maf
